    @alexthegreat0234 2 месяца назад

    To hatch it, I toss the cysts in about a quart and a half of room temperature water, add 2 tablespoons of sea salt, and then use a bubbler to churn it until they hatch. They usually hatch after about a day.

    @T3vearris 3 месяца назад

    Dude, when you pour your MASTER, put the box on a shaker table with a 240hz~480hz transducer. Not full ultrasonic because detalis and glues/resins/details make crack. But it will force all the air out of the smallest of knooks and crannys and allow full flow. This will also work when you pour the plastic into the sillicone mold. Please look into this. You will never go back.
